Kimberly Rivera: Kimberly Rivera pleaded guilty Monday to two counts of desertion and was sentenced to the prison term and received a bad-conduct discharge, according to CTV. During a two-week leave in the U.S. in 2007, Rivera crossed the Canadian border after she was ordered to serve another tour in Iraq and COLORADO SPRINGS, Colo. -- A soldier in the U.S. Army who fled to Canada to avoid a second tour of duty in Iraq has been sentenced to 10 months in prison. The 30-year-old has said she became disillusioned with the U.S. mission in Iraq while serving there in 2006.
